
Sweet Vietnamese Pandan Layer Cake with Coconut Cream
A Deliciously Layered Dessert Delight
This vibrant Vietnamese cake, Bánh Da Lợn, features the delicate and aromatic flavors of pandan and coconut, elegantly layered for a sweet treat that's as beautiful as it is tasty.

Preparation
Preparing the Mung Bean Paste
Steam Mung Beans
Drain the soaked mung beans and steam until soft, about 20 minutes.
Blend Beans
Blend the steamed mung beans with water until smooth.
Cook Mung Bean Paste
Cook the mung bean paste with sugar, coconut milk, and salt over medium heat, stirring constantly until thickened. Set aside to cool.
Preparing the Pandan Batter
Mix Dry Ingredients
Combine rice flour, tapioca starch, and sugar in a mixing bowl.
Add Liquids
Gradually whisk in coconut milk and pandan extract until smooth and lump-free.
Ensure there are no lumps in your batter for even layering. Adjust the level of pandan extract to control the depth of green color.
Rest the Batter
Allow the batter to rest for 30 minutes.
Cooking Process
Steam Mung Bean Layer
Pour a layer of mung bean paste into a greased cake pan; steam for 10 minutes.
Steam Pandan Layers
Gently pour a layer of pandan batter over the mung bean paste; steam for 8 minutes. Repeat alternating layers until all batter is used.
Steam Coconut Cream Topping
Pour coconut cream mixture on top of the final layer; steam for an additional 10 minutes.

Plating & Serving
Carefully remove the cake from the pan and slice into individual portions before serving. Enjoy the aromatic layers with a drizzle of additional coconut cream.
